The partition manifest for the October segment is signed at creation, and the verifier now rejects it, likely because the migration rewrote partition boundaries without re-signing. Reviewer, please check whether the re-sign hook was dropped from the DDL wrapper in the refactor. To reproduce locally, run the verifier against the staging manifest using the key below.

deploy key for kajof-fajop: bky6_gDHw9Q

Heads up, support folks: we changed the websocket compression defaults in Ferngate 4.2. Compression is now off for messages under 1 KB — the CPU cost wasn't worth the tiny bandwidth win, and a few kiosks were lagging. Larger payloads still compress as before. If someone complains about bandwidth spikes, this is probably why. The new defaults ship as the following values.

settings of tagef-bawif:
DRUIX_HOST=druix.zemvarlabs.internal
DRUIX_PORT=8000

## Environments — Harborline SFTP Drop

The Harborline service maintains three environments for the partner SFTP drop: sandbox, staging, and production. Each environment uses a separate chroot and distinct host keys, rotated quarterly. Staging mirrors production file layouts exactly, so partner dry runs there are authoritative for release sign-off. Before approving a release, verify that the staging intake matches the values currently deployed, which are listed here.

config for kafof-bawef:
holath:
  log_level: debug
  metrics_host: metrics.holath.qorvelsys.internal
  pin: 2191
  pool_size: 32

### Step 4: Enable soft deletes on orders

Run `cartwheel migrate --tag soft-delete` against the Orderloft database. This adds `deleted_at` to the orders table; nothing is dropped. Then set SOFT_DELETE_ENABLED=true in the app's `.env` and restart the workers. Purge jobs authenticate separately, so the purge credential must also be present. Add it on the line immediately after.

sealed setting: ARCHIVE_KEY3=8d0